Industrial safety inspectors spend their days walking facilities: checking machine guarding, lockout/tagout compliance, fall protection, air quality readings, fire systems, forklift operations, and whether anyone has once again wedged the emergency exit open with a pallet. They document violations, write corrective-action reports, run incident investigations after someone gets hurt, train workers on procedures, and keep the OSHA-required paperwork defensible for the day regulators or lawyers come asking.
The detection layer is automating fast. Fixed sensors now monitor air quality, noise, temperature, and gas leaks continuously instead of quarterly. Computer vision watches camera feeds for missing hard hats, blocked exits, and workers entering restricted zones, flagging violations in real time rather than whenever the inspector's rotation comes around. Wearables track heat stress and proximity to moving equipment. Drones inspect tank roofs and rafters nobody wants to climb to. A continuous monitoring stack simply catches more than a periodic human sweep — this isn't close, and safety managers know it.
What the stack can't do is everything after detection. Deciding whether a flagged condition is a real hazard or a camera artifact. Conducting an incident investigation where the root cause is a production-pressure culture, not a missing guard. Having the authority conversation with a plant manager who wants to skip the shutdown. Testifying about compliance. And regulation still requires qualified humans to certify inspections — OSHA doesn't accept a dashboard screenshot. Our score of 60 reflects a role that shifts from patrolling to supervising the systems that patrol: fewer inspectors, more analysts, and a hard premium on investigation and enforcement skills.

Continuous monitoring is deploying across heavy industry now, and the routine-patrol portion of inspection work erodes through the late 2020s as vision systems and sensor networks get cheaper than salaries. By around 2030, expect notably fewer clipboard-and-rounds positions and a consolidated role — safety professionals who interpret the monitoring data, investigate incidents, and enforce fixes. Regulatory requirements for human certification slow the slide but don't stop the headcount math.

Continuous sensors and computer vision already detect violations better than periodic human rounds, so the walking-and-checklist share of the job is shrinking hard. What remains — incident investigation, judgment calls, enforcement conversations, regulatory certification — needs humans. Fewer inspectors, doing higher-level work, supervising machine surveillance. Our risk score of 60 is about headcount, not extinction.
Yes, if you enter it as a technical and investigative discipline rather than an auditing one. Demand for safety professionals who can run monitoring systems, analyze incident data, and drive culture change is healthy. Demand for people whose core skill is completing checklists is not. Credential up (CSP-track) and get fluent in the sensor and analytics stack early.
No. Regulations require qualified people to conduct certain inspections, certify equipment, investigate incidents, and sign documentation — a dashboard can't carry legal accountability. Automation feeds the compliance process better data, and it will thin out the routine-monitoring roles, but the responsible human in the loop is baked into the regulatory structure for the foreseeable future.
Volunteer for every technology pilot your employer runs — vision analytics, wearables, drone inspections — so you're the operator, not the casualty. Sharpen investigation and data-analysis skills. Move your value from 'I find hazards' to 'I prevent recurrence and change behavior.' The inspectors who thrive will manage a fleet of sensors the way patrol officers became dispatchers.
